WebYou may have heard that five words in a row is considered plagiarism. We would like to give you that kind of clear-cut standard for judging when you have plagiarized. But plagiarism is more a matter of context than of a specific number of words.

WebJun 29, 2016 · There is no single "number of words" threshold, because the issue is the degree of creativity and salience in the choice of words, which is dependent on the exact phrase and context. If those few words are extremely significant and clearly attributable to a particular person, you might need to quote them, e.g.: "Eat my shorts" (Simpson, 1997)
WebPlagiarism means using someone else’s work without giving them proper credit. In academic writing, plagiarizing involves using words, ideas, or information from a source without citing it correctly. In practice, this can mean a few different things. Why is it wrong? It makes it seem like these are your own words.
